Tensions hit a breaking point on The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ills Season 15 reunion. And this time, Kyle Richards refuses to stay quiet.

She walks in ready. Phone in hand. Receipts loaded.

During a heated exchange, Kyle revisits the moment she skipped Dorit Kemsley’s book cover event. Instead of brushing it off, she reads the exact message she sent:

“Hi, I’m so sorry that I’m not going to make it tonight. I’m exhausted and overwhelmed and have been up since 2 a.m.”

Then she drops Dorit’s reply:

“I get it. No worries. Thank you for the good luck wishes. Take care of yourself.”

Kyle looks stunned even while reading it. She insists Dorit was “fine with that” at the time.

RHOBH: “So You’re Full of Sh*t Then?”

The mood flips fast.

Kyle accuses Dorit of switching up later to make her look bad. She does not hold back:

“So you’re full of sh*t then? So your text was not being genuine?”

Dorit fires back instantly. No hesitation.

“No, that’s called being polite. What am I supposed to say? I’m not going to beg anyone to come support me.”

That line lands hard. It exposes something deeper than a missed event. It feels personal.

RHOBH: Andy Cohen Steps In But It Gets Worse

Host Andy Cohen tries to calm things down. It does not work.

He asks if Kyle misunderstood the tone of the message. Dorit says yes. Kyle interrupts before Dorit can even explain her feelings fully.

The conversation spirals again. Voices overlap. No one backs down.

At one point, Kyle even accuses Dorit of enjoying the moment:

“Oh, good, I get to make Kyle look like an a*shole. I love it!”

RHOBH: Business Drama Enters the Chat

Then comes another layer. Business support.

Dorit brings up her memoir Unburdened. She suggests the group should support each other more. Kyle disagrees and points to past support.

Dorit shuts that down quickly:

“I know you’d like to go back 10 years, Kyle, but I’m actually staying within this decade.”

Kyle snaps back:

“It’s called history, Dorit. It’s one f*cking thing. You don’t have the book out. It was a picture.”

RHOBH: Reunion Part 1 Already Set the Tone

The chaos did not start here.

Part 1 already delivered emotional moments. Erika Jayne opened up about her past with Tom Girardi:

“I called the cops. I gave this person a chance to leave.”

She described emotional and financial abuse. The cast supported her.

Meanwhile, Dorit also accused Kyle of sharing information behind her back. Kyle denied it. The tension was already boiling.
